Troops of Sector 8, Operation ENDURING PEACE, foils an attempted attack on Manja community in Mangu Local Government Area of Plateau State

By Tony Charles, Jos

The incident occurred on Saturday after security personnel received information about the movement of armed men suspected to be planning an attack on the community.

Security analyst Zagazola Makama disclosed the development in a post on X on Sunday, stating that troops swiftly mobilised to the area following the security alert.

The troops’ intervention reportedly forced the suspected attackers to withdraw into nearby bushes with their cattle before they could carry out the planned assault on the community.

According to the report, security personnel later received another alert at about 4:12 p.m. concerning an attempt by the suspected attackers to gain access to Manja village.

Troops immediately launched a pursuit operation while maintaining a strong security presence around the community to deter any further attempt to infiltrate the area.

The security forces also intensified offensive patrols and clearance operations across the surrounding areas as part of measures to prevent the suspected attackers from regrouping or returning to the community.

The operations were aimed at maintaining pressure on the armed group while securing residents and vulnerable locations within Manja and neighbouring communities.

Security sources said troops remained deployed in the area as operations continued, with personnel conducting patrols and monitoring the surrounding terrain.

The sustained military presence is expected to reassure residents and strengthen efforts to prevent further attacks, particularly in communities considered vulnerable to armed incursions.

The latest operation underscores the importance of timely intelligence and rapid military response in preventing attacks before they are carried out.

Authorities are expected to maintain the security operation around Manja and adjoining communities while continuing efforts to identify and neutralise threats to residents and their property.
